Gastric carcinoma in siblings with Friedreich's ataxia
R Ackroyd1, A J Shorthouse, T J Stephenson
1Department of Surgery, Royal Hallamshire Hospital, Sheffield, UK.
Abstract:
Friedreich's ataxia is a hereditary neurological condition characterized by severe ataxia. We report the cases of two siblings with this condition, both of whom developed signet ring cell adenocarcinoma of the stomach at a young age. This association has not been previously described and it suggests the presence of an unidentified aberrant gene.
